Output 94c12a24870182c1f274d3c2444e9f306fb5948aac1d18732188f21194a09b6f:0

value
537350700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51dafe48bd011602341371fedf2cef07bf49483f OP_EQUAL
address
MFMyJtYZPhtyuuFWVcqKkgEhXLsozfNo94
transaction
94c12a24870182c1f274d3c2444e9f306fb5948aac1d18732188f21194a09b6f
spent
true